NOT used in scabies ?

A
BHC
B
Permethrin
C
Ciclopirox oleamine
D
Crotamiton
High-Yield Explanation
Ciclopirox oleamine Scabies is caused by a mite (Sarcoptes Scabiei var hominis) specific for human. Scabicides used in the tit of scabies Scabicide Method of use Comments * Permethrin (5%) 1 application * Benzylbenzoate 3 application at Irritation 12 hourly intervals * Gamma benzene hexachloride (BHC) (1%) 1 application Seizures * Crotamiton 10% 2 applications daily x 14 d useful in children mild antipruritic * Ivermectin Single oral dose 200 lag/kg body weight
